Output 4366d6ef433f25f7583ebfc5b3c041334e4e890cb1beba57effa4fa3ed9665ab:0

value
3999000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d7f004a0f83f257e09ed66c5bcb82db5faaa0a OP_EQUAL
address
3PC3QEFkmcVK6eHvTvc4B2WbuefC7PZR4V
transaction
4366d6ef433f25f7583ebfc5b3c041334e4e890cb1beba57effa4fa3ed9665ab
spent
true